Subject: sctp: translate host order to network order when setting a hmacid
From: lucien <lucien.xin@gmail.com>
[ Upstream commit ed5a377d87dc4c87fb3e1f7f698cba38cd893103 ]
now sctp auth cannot work well when setting a hmacid manually, which
is caused by that we didn't use the network order for hmacid, so fix
it by adding the transformation in sctp_auth_ep_set_hmacs.
even we set hmacid with the network order in userspace, it still
can't work, because of this condition in sctp_auth_ep_set_hmacs():
if (id > SCTP_AUTH_HMAC_ID_MAX)
return -EOPNOTSUPP;
so this wasn't working before and thus it won't break compatibility.
